1、 - 1 - 摘摘 要要 在我国应用范围比较广泛的是机械式发条定时器,但在实际应用中所产生 的问题比较多,走时不准,易停摆等问题严重影响定时器的质量。 本文在对机械式发条式定时器其缺点分析的基础上提出了基于数字电路技 术的定时器设计方案。这个定时器电路比较简单,成本低,便于维修,省去了 机械定时器每次必须扭动定时按钮的麻烦,对电器的全自动化很有利。由振荡 器产生方波后经过分频器分别产生周期为的方波,分别用来减计数和加计数, 这两种方波通过计数器后输出 BCD 码,BCD 码通过发光二极管进行显示。 首先,根据设计要求,设计电路原理方框图,然后,通过对电路原理的分 析,对电路元件进行选择并设定相
